“Sevilla was the difficult opponent that we all expected. They went ahead with the penalty and there was a phase in which our lives were complicated,” he admitted Müller in statements to the channel 'Sky ’.

The German player added that the Seville had come up with formulas to escape the pressure of Bayern but that in the final part of the game his team had managed to print its stamp on the game.

Praise for the scorer Javi Martínez

Müller had words of praise for his partner Javi
Martinez, author of the winning goal, and said he believed that “in thirty years he will continue to be a great header.”
